Fine.  A couple of notes.  The Samsung controller is compatible with 
the Hitachi controller so this means all of these parallel LCD 
Assemblies will be compatible.

I would propose an ATTINY2313 for the LCD support PCB.  Note that this 
PCB would contain only the following parts:

ATTINY2313 20 pin DIP
14 pin header to connect to LCD Assembly
3 or 4 pin header to connect to CVS PC
  (Tx, Reset, Ground, and possibly +5)
Input power connector for the LCD Assembly backlight
Current limit resistor for the LCD Assembly backlight
8 MHz crystal and two 22 pF capacitors
Optional 6 pin header to program the ATTINY2313 in-circuit
Optional contrast potentiometer (my experience is to run the LCD
  at full contrast with no potentiometer)

Alternatives for the +5 volt power are:
1) Use the CVS PCB.  Power for the ATTINY2313 is 6 mA. The LCD 
Assembly selected has a separate 2 pin connector for the backlight. 
This could be powered from +15 volts with a current limit resistor or 
from +5 volts with a current limit resistor if available from the 
power supply.

2) Local +5 volt regulation for the ATTINY2313 and power the backlight 
from +15 volts with a current limit resistor.

3) Power both the ATTINY2313 and backlight from +5 volts with a 
current limit resistor if available from the power supply.
